Putting Berries In Hot Water. Learning how to clean strawberries with hot water will all them to stay fresh for longer, rather than go bad quickly. A quick bath in hot water will also work to destroy bacteria and mold spores. Dunk your berries in water between 120°f and 140°f for approximately 30 seconds.
